This is great Spacey! Mind if I give you some of those pointers you were looking for? I'll go easy on you, I promise. :)

The first thing that sticks out to me is....I'd of loved to have heard that acoustic mic'd. Just a pet peeve of mine and I know you weren't going for perfection here, but the lined in acoustic type sound just ain't for me. If it's mic'd, my apologies...it just sounds DI or acoustic pup-like. Good sound though for what it is.

Bass is definitely a bit too boomy for my taste and could use a high pass and maybe a slight bump at about 2.5-3k to make the transients in the execution come out a bit more.

Kick drum is definitely boomy if it exists...something comes in that appears to be a kick of sorts at one point...or maybe that's the low end on the bass thumping from 1:24?

Vocals are beautifully executed. Two issues I hear though. The first is you could probably low pass a bit on them as they seemed to have a bit too much air and sizzle in them. The other issue is....I can hear the vocal punch-in spaces. They come in as little clicks and excessive breaths that should either be eliminated in my opinion, or faded in if you want to keep some of the breathiness. But the punch clicks are apparent to me...so I'd definitely remove those.

But the timbre's on everything and levels are really good and of course the performances on everything are awesome! Definitely an acceptable mix if you totally discard everything I've said. A great attempt considering your time off as well as using a totally new program. Nicely done...thanks for sharing and I hope you do so more often. :)
